    Even if she may have been concealing her excitement, Kalil could tell that the filly was eager to see what lay in store for them at the coast, where the ocean lay and stretched on for miles past the horizon. Her gait was calm and steady, but eager, a stark contrast to Kalil's excited prancing. Understandable, to a degree; perhaps she was just hesitant since she'd never been near the ocean before, she didn't know what to expect.

    But that was why Kalil was so excited to share it with her; to show her the wonders and mysteries of the ocean, and give her a new lease on life by exposing it's beauty. Another reason why his excitement shown as brightly as the sun when he bucked and kicked amongst the waves in excitement.

    Kalil's golden coat was turned a dark honey brown due to the salt water that soaked through his skin, but it did not diminish the elegant appearance he carried as he waded among the waves. Ruth seemed to hesitate a moment up on the beach before throwing caution to the wind and charging in to the ocean. A wave grew in size as the filly made her way out, seeming to catch her off guard since Ruth had to regain her balance when it crested and crashed down near the beach. Despite this, she recovered just fine, spinning around in her tracks to locate the golden colt.

    Having spent a lot of time around the ocean, Kalil could hear just fine over the typical roaring noise that waves made, either during high or low tide, so it wasn't as hard for him to hear as other horses may initially figure. Still, the filly's soft voice, like a gentle breeze among a winter storm, just barely caught his ears, and the colt turned to see her wading toward him.

    To help in case the waves decided to start growing bigger as the tide came in, Kalil moved a few strides toward the beach to where the water would've stopped at their knees. He smiled at Ruthless as she got closer to him, hearing her comment about his sire.

    For a moment, in turn, Kalil could only watch her. She was a rather pretty filly, which was the maximum the colt's feelings reached at still a young age. Her golden coat, much like his dam's save for the dark markings, glistened with health in the sun, her silky mane and tail a shade between pure snow white and platinum like he'd seen on some other golden horses. Her limbs were strong and she carried herself gracefully, her hazel eyes on the colt as she came closer.

    "Yeah, he's a pretty great guy," Kalil offered back, "He says he's made mistakes in the past, but I heard him joking with Mother that he says that so I won't idolize him too much. I don't know though, it doesn't seem like he could make a lot of mistakes when it comes to our family. Mother says everything he's done has been for us, and that includes you now too."

    His smile grew, "That is, if you'd like to be part of our family. I know my Mother and siblings would love to have you, if you choose to stay here in Taiga. It's a great place to live, well protected, and there are plenty of friendly faces here. Plus, amazing sights like this," he glanced back out at the ocean briefly, "And if you decide you'd like to learn about protecting a kingdom or diplomacy some day, my Father and Mother could help teach you that too."
